How is Mary Magdalene depicted?
The fourth-century Mary of Egypt was a hermit who lived in the desert, and whose clothes wore out and fell off. This gave licence to artists to depict Mary Magdalene as naked, covered by her hair (sometimes actually with long, flowing body hair).What is so special about Mary Magdalene?
St. Mary Magdalene was a disciple of Jesus. According to the Gospel accounts, Jesus cleansed her of seven demons, and she financially aided him in Galilee. She was one of the witnesses of the Crucifixion and burial of Jesus and, famously, was the first person to see him after the Resurrection.What is the theme of Mary Magdalene?

Mary's epithet Magdalene may mean that she came from the town of Magdala, a fishing town on the western shore of the Sea of Galilee in Roman Judea.Why is Mary Magdalene associated with red?

Mary Magdalene is the patron saint of perfumers and is associated with prostitutes. She was present at Christ's Crucifixion and burial. She is also associated with the sinful woman who repented and anointed Christ's feet with perfumed oil (Luke 7:36-9).Why is Mary Magdalene shown with a skull?
This may seem a very dark representation, but its purpose is to remember or to be aware of our mortality. As Magdalene is shown contemplating the skull, she reflects and makes us reflects on the fact that one day we will be dead, and it would be better if we are close to God.What Colours represent Mary?
